Alumni Arena is where the Buffalo Bulls (9-20) will attempt to defeat the Miami RedHawks (21-8) on Tuesday.

The Miami RedHawks played Ohio and walked away from this one with a loss by a score of 75-66 in their last contest. Miami walked away from the game with a 42.6% field goal percentage (26 of 61) and converted 8 of their 29 shots from downtown. From the free throw line, the RedHawks converted 6 of 10 shots for a percentage of 60.0%. When discussing getting rebounds, they collected 31 with 7 of them being on the offensive end. They also recorded 13 assists for this game while creating 10 turnovers and getting 7 steals. When it comes to the defense, Miami allowed the other team to go 50.8% from the field on 30 of 59 shooting. Ohio recorded 15 dimes and had 9 steals in this game. In addition, Ohio snagged 27 rebounds (6 offensive, 21 defensive), but couldn't earn a rejection. Ohio ended up going 57.1% from the free throw line by burying 8 of their 14 attempts. They knocked down 7 out of their 18 tries from long range. When talking about fouls, the RedHawks ended up finishing with 18 and Ohio finished the game with 13 fouls.
Antwone Woolfolk is someone who was a major factor for the game. He accounted for 16 points on 7 of 9 shooting. He played 24 mins and collected 3 rebounds. He finished the contest at 77.8% from the field and distributed 1 assist.

Miami comes into this contest with a win-loss mark of 21-8 on the campaign. They average 81.0 points per contest (32nd in the nation) while hitting 48.5% from the field. The RedHawks are hitting 39.1% on shots from downtown (301 of 770) and 72.9% from the charity stripe. As a team, Miami is grabbing 33.7 rebounds per contest and has accounted for 465 assists on the year, which ranks 56th in D-1 in terms of passing. They are losing possession via turnover 12.3 times per game and as a team they are committing 18.0 personal fouls on a nightly basis.
When they are on defense, the RedHawks are forcing their opponents into 14.7 turnovers every game while drawing 17.0 personal fouls. They relinquish 34.8% from beyond the arc and they are ranked 219th in college hoops in PPG from their opponents (73.2). The RedHawks defense is giving up a shooting percentage of 45.2% (744 of 1,646) and they relinquish 33.0 boards per contest as a unit. They are ranked 132nd in college hoops in giving up assists with 373 surrendered this season.
The last time they took the court, the Buffalo Bulls took home the win by a final score of 87-74 when they played Toledo. The Bulls earned 18 defensive boards and 5 offensive rebounds totaling 23 for this game. They coughed up the ball 14 times, while recording 7 steals in this contest. Toledo had 12 fouls for the game which got the Bulls to the charity stripe for a total of 7 tries. They were able to make 4 of the free throw attempts for a percentage of 57.1%. When it comes to shots from distance, Buffalo made 13 out of their 23 attempts (56.5%). When the final whistle blew, the Bulls ended up going 35 out of 56 from the floor which had them shooting 62.5%. The Bulls allowed Toledo to make 28 out of 54 attempts from the floor which had them shooting 51.9% in this contest. They finished the game shooting 38.5% from 3-point land by connecting on 5 of 13 and ended up shooting 13 out of 15 from the free throw line (86.7%). When it comes to rebounding, Buffalo allowed Toledo to grab 20 in total (5 on the offensive glass).
Tyson Dunn was important for the Bulls for the contest. He buried 10 of 14 for the matchup for a field goal rate of 71.4%, but couldn't coral a rebound. He tallied 26 points in his 31 mins of playing time and had 3 assists for this contest.
Buffalo has a mark of 9-20 on the year. As an offensive unit, the Bulls are connecting on 42.7% from the floor, which has them ranked 294th in college hoops. Buffalo has scored 2,087 pts this season (72.0 per game) and they average 34.6 boards per contest. They are dishing out assists 13.6 times per contest (187th in college hoops) and they are giving up possession 14.7 times per game. The Bulls have committed 16.9 personal fouls per contest and they connect on 69.3% from the charity stripe.
The Buffalo defense allows 36.0% from downtown (238 of 662) and their opponents are connecting on 72.5% of their free throw shots. They have surrendered 15.4 dimes and 38.8 rebounds per contest, which has them ranked 331st and 349th in those defensive categories. The Bulls defensively are ranked 352nd in college hoops in points per game surrendered with 80.6. They have forced 12.8 TO's every game and allow teams to shoot 46.8% from the field (334th in college hoops).
